Ruby - super intelligent girl
Ruby is beautiful looking girl with a personality to match and is about 3.5-4 years old and in very good health. She is completley housetrained and will ask at the door when she needs to go out. Ruby loves toys and the chewier the better. Her favourite game is tug and she also enjoys playing fetch. She loves to chew and must be provided with plenty of appropriate chew toys so that she doesn't choose her own!
Ruby sleeps all night in her crate without any fuss. Once exercised Ruby is happiest flaking out on the sofa beside (or on top of) her favourite person - she actually thinks she is a lap-dog!
Ruby has all of her basic cues and some tricks too and loves learning and working - she is an extremely trainable dog. She has recently learned how to play dead! Her leash walking is very good and is continuing to improve as she becomes more and more comfortable with urban living. She is calm even when faced with rude dogs barking and lunging at her. She is easily led away by her person without looking for trouble. She alerts to the door but calms quickly and greets everyone she meets with so much affection you would think that she knew them all of her life! Ruby is bomb proof as regards handling and resource guarding and there are no issues here whatsoever.
Ruby is good with children over 6 years of age and is very gentle with them. She is not good with cats though so can't go to a home with a cat. Other than that she will fit in brilliantly to any active dog loving home. Ruby would be fine to live with a male companion but we think that she would prefer to have her people all to herself - only-child syndrome!!
Ruby is the perfect size and type to be someone's running partner so would be perfect for a sporty owner. In fact we think its really important that Ruby have some sort of extra-curricular activity in her new life whether that be jogging, agility or some other activity. Ruby is a special dog - I have never met a dog with such an amazing personality, she is so soft and affectionate. She loves to play and is all about having fun. She is devoted to her people and will make the best companion for someone.
Her ideal home would be one where she would not be left alone for long periods or where she could go to work with her owner. There will never be another Ruby so don't miss your chance - get her while you can! Ruby is neutered, fully vax'd and microchipped.
